Utsunomiya City is a front runner among candidates for introduction of a new LRT system aiming to create an attractive and sustainable city. In recent years, residents' preferences are increasingly reflected in the city planning process in Japan. Therefore, it is crucial to provide residents with appropriate information about LRT. This study is intended to examine the change of residents' consciousness in the face of better understanding about the future image of LRT. According to the field survey in Utsunomiya, it is clear that the improvement of residents' comprehension promotes attitude formation about pros and cons related to the planning of LRT. Therefore, it is very important to encourage better communications among various parties involved in the planning process to achieve a successful LRT project.

Transit networks such as those of buses, subways, express buses, and regional railways have long served as the backbone of public transportation. In order for a transit network to attract more users, its efficiency or convenience, among other things, should be maintained at an acceptable level. Although there could be several ways to measure the efficiency or convenience of a transit network, this paper proposes the concept of connectivity, which quantifies how well or easily users can access from one point of a transit network to other points. In particular, this paper aims to develop a quantitative model for measuring the level of connectivity of a node of a transit network. By applying the model to subway networks in South Korea, we compute connectivity indexes of subway stations from which connectivity indexes of subway lines are also derived. The connectivity index of a subway line considering transfer is also calculated.

Passenger service time mainly depends on numbers of passenger boarding and alighting, and fare collection process. Understanding the impact of fare collection with multiple fare media helps to reduce the variation of passenger service time. This paper has attempted to study the effect of existence of multiple fare media for fare collection purpose on passenger service time. It is natural that the IC card payment and commuting passes consume least time for fare payment processing. However, when bus rider uses exact required coin, its marginal payment time is not significantly different with other fare media. Also, the predecessor's fare payment process has no significant effect over the follower's payment process. Thus, multiple fare media can embraces wide variety of users who can select fare media according to their ease and also supports implementation of complex fare policy including fare transfer policy.

This paper reviews the current statutory and operational system of urban bus service and reports the impacts of the regulation system on the local bus market in five mega cities in Asia: Bangkok, Hanoi, Singapore, Tokyo, and Yangon. The bus-related laws/acts are collected through interviews with government officials in the cities. The results show that the definition of vehicle types, the fare regulations, responsibilities of public and private sectors, and the permission system of urban bus operation vary among the cities. Then, the paper proposes the Index of Market Intervention for Urban Bus with which the degree of market intervention by the government is evaluated in a given bus market. Finally, the paper presents the recommendations: the differentiation of regulation for small-sized vehicles from that for large-sized vehicles, the transparent decision-making process of fare setting in unstable markets, and the private management under the well-organized control of government.

The research focuses on the comparative analysis of three popular types of bus lane operation including roadside exclusive bus lane, bus priority lane and ordinary lane. The analysis is firstly conducted based on simulation tests in Paramics with assumed data about traffic arterial road and input parameters. Then, to evaluate the results, a case study is introduced. This case study is conducted in Nagaoka city at an urban street with a large number of buses going through and a high traffic volume. The results show that with the current traffic situation, once it is deployed, the bus priority lane type can help reduce by 1.2 sec for each passenger traveling on 500m long segment compared with the current ordinary lane type. Choosing the bus lane types in terms of travel time is also investigated in a sensitive relation with the main traffic volume and the number of passengers on the bus

Small irregularities in service are leading to significant delays in the urban railway system of Tokyo, Japan, because the rail system is now operating very close to its capacity. The increase in train running time becomes the major cause during the later rush hours, which is longer than that of dwelling time. However, the case of the delay time increase due to an interaction between trains is not properly accounted. Therefore, this research formulated a train operation simulation model which reproduces the behavior of train operation taking into account the interaction between the trains. Using this simulation model, this study attempted to grasp an actual situation of train operation under the knock-on delay, and suggested a practically method to recover the knock-on delay earlier, which involves keeping the moderate separation between trains during running time.

This paper conducts a field survey with cameras at intersections to collect and analyze pedestrian walking speeds with one factor and multiple factors. Following regression analysis and factor identification, this paper also develops a prediction model for pedestrian walking speed. Results show that the mean speed of male adults is significantly higher than that of female adults in most cases. The mean walking speed of individual crossers is higher than the mean speeds of a group of two people or a group of three or more people. People walk faster on cold days, but slower on rainy days. People tend to increase their walking speed when walking across a wider street or an intersection without pedestrian control devices. In addition, regression analysis shows that the walking speed for pedestrians is significantly affected by the factors of sex, temperature, weather, number of lanes, signal type, and pedestrian phase length.

Existing signal control strategies do not consider pedestrian flows in optimizing signal parameters, which may impose significant delays on pedestrians. This study aims to investigate the rationality and effectiveness of designing signal coordination for pedestrians. A Japanese numerical case study is analyzed. Field survey is conducted to collect the geometric characteristics, signal timings and vehicular traffic condition information. In a parallel approach, the performances of signal coordination for vehicular and pedestrian traffic are estimated by using the vehicular simulation tool Synchro/SimTraffic and the pedestrian simulation tool NOMAD. The results showed that the coordination for the major pedestrian flow led to a significant reduction in average delay (15%). Generally, it is concluded that the effectiveness of pedestrian signal coordination is not guaranteed but depends on the relationship between pedestrian platoon dispersion and the signal cycle length.

This study was conducted to analyze changes in transit trips in accordance with weather conditions. Thus far, most researches have analyzed the characteristics of public transport in accordance with weather conditions, with the main analysis verifying the relation between road traffic and weather conditions. These researches estimated the monthly factor and the daily factor of public transport trips in order to consider only the weather conditions; therefore, this study was carried out to estimate the daily and monthly factors directly. On days of rainfall, it was found that there was a reduced demand for the subway and bus. When compared to the peak, the daily trip demand decreased at a larger percentage by the level of rainfall. During the peak hour demand of the subway, it was difficult to find a close relationship with the level of rainfall.

The paper is based on an analysis of experience and attitudes toward public transport accessibility of residents from number of cities in three different countries in East Asia. The work presented explores an analytical framework suitable to incorporate differences of city characteristics from different regions. It is then demonstrated that there is a quantifiable relationship between the level of service of accessibility to public transport systems in a given urban area and expectations and attitudes of its residents. The paper provides a framework for planners to identify the net perceived value of improvements to accessibility by accounting for the difference between the improvement of a physical measure of accessibility and the increased level of expectation of the subject community. The analysis has shown that it is important to keep the walking time below a specific value to ensure that the level of service associated with accessibility is within community expectations.

For the highway-rail grade crossings, there are some types of traffic control. The traffic control for highway-rail grade crossings include all signs, signals, markings and other warning devices. It also includes their supports along highways approaching and at highway-rail grade crossings. The function of this traffic control is to permit safe and efficient operation of both highway and rail traffic at highway-rail grade crossings. The paper reports the review on the existing regulation required on the separated highway-rail grade crossings. The review is based on the result of traffic analysis at several highway-rail grade crossings with different specification (road and railroad geometric, traffic and location). The result of traffic analysis becomes the main input for benefit and cost analysis that is end up with the decision of intersection handling. The result of the whole analysis would become the basis of the Standard of Highway-Rail Grade Crossings in Indonesia.
